Occupation Time Statistics in the Quenched Trap Model

Abstract

We investigate the distribution of occupation times for a particle undergoing a random walk among random energy traps and in the presence of a deterministic potential field . When the distribution of energy traps is exponential with a width we find that the occupation time statistics behaves according to (i) the canonical Boltzmann theory when , (ii) while for they are distributed according to the Lamperti distribution with the asymmetry of the distribution determined by the Boltzmann factor with and not being the effective temperature. We explain how our results describe occupation times in other systems with quenched disorder, when the underlying partition function of the problem is a random variable distributed according to Lévy statistics.
